《英语》课程考试系统的设计与实现》.doc

《英语》课程考试系统的设计与实现》.doc

  1. 1、本文档共19页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
通达学院 专业课程设计II 题 目:《英语》课程考试系统的设计与实现》 专 业 计算机科学与技术(计算机通信) 学 生 姓 名 班 级 学 号 指 导 教 师 指 导 单 位 计算机学院计算机科学与技术系 日 期 2012.11.12-2012.11.23 《英语》课程考试系统的设计与实现 课题内容和要求 需求分析概要设计 Answer字段表示答案选项 (9)Type字段表示试题类型 (10)subjectname字段代表试题所属科目名称 2.subject表结构 subject表 字段名称 类型 说明 Multiper 数字 常整型 Singleper 数字 常整型 multinumber 数字 常整型 singlenumber 数字 常整型 subjectname 文本 字段大小50 Testtime 数字 常整型 Id 自动编号 常整型,递增,主键 各字段说明: (1)multiper字段代表在某考试科目的考试题中每个多选题的分值。 (2)singleper字段代表在某考试科目的考试题中每个单选题的分值。 (3)multinumber字段为某科的多选题题量。 (4)singlenumber字段为某科的多选题题量。 (5)subjectname字段代表科目名称。 (6)testtime字段代表某科的考试总时间。 (7)id字段代表科目的id号。 3.score表结构 score表 字段名称 类型 说明 Studentname 文本 字段大小50 Subjectname 文本 字段大小50 Score 数字 常整型 Id 自动编号 常整型,递增,主键 Endtime 日期/时间 各字段说明: (1)studentname字段代表在某次考试记录中学生的名字。 (2)subjectname字段代表在某次考试纪录中考试科目名。 (3)score字段为某次考试纪录中考试分数。 (4)id字段为某次考试纪录的标志号。 (5)endtime字段代表考试的结束时间。 4.student表结构 student表 字段名称 类型 说明 Studentname 文本 字段大小50 Studentpassword 文本 字段大小50 Id 自动编号 常整型,递增,主键 各字段说明: (1)studentname字段代表学生的名字。 (2)studentpassword字段代表密码。 (3)id字段为学生的标志号。 5.admin表结构 admin表 字段名称 类型 说明 Name 文本 字段大小50 Password 文本 字段大小50 Id 自动编号 常整型,递增,主键 各字段说明: (1)name字段代表管理员的名字。 (2)password字段代表密码。 (3)id字段为管理员的标志号。 该系统主要分为两部分 一、用户登录: 首先系统要有一个登录界面default.asp,用户登录该界面参加考试。 在考生正确输入用户名和密码以后,接着应该进入考试科目选择界面。在selectsubject.asp该界面上,考生选择参加考试的科目。 进入开始考试界面test.asp,考生进行考试,答完试题后交卷, 由计算机进行处理--判卷,得出考试分数,在result.asp中显示出来,并把该生考试记录存入数据库。 二、管理员登陆(admin) (1)管理员在login.asp登录以后,应该有一个管理项目选择界面primarypage.asp,其中包括管理用户选项、管理管理员选项、管理考试科目选项、管理考试纪录选项以及管理各科试题选项。 (2)管理用户的界面mgadmin.asp可以实现用户的增加、和删除的功能,管理员在此可以对用户进行管理。考试科目界面mgsunject.asp用来增加或删除考试的科目,考试纪录界面mgscore.asp可以对考生的每次考试进行纪录,管理员科可以对考生成绩、考试科目、时间及考试各相关纪录进行查询和删除。试题库管理界面mgquestion.asp,它根据各科进行分类。通过这个界面管理员可以对题库中的某科试题进行增加、修改或删除。 详细设计 <conn.asp页介绍> 该文件实现的是连接数据库和断开连接的功能。 文件中主要是定义了两个过程conn_init()和endConnection()。第一个是连接数据库,第二个是实现断开连接。其中conn_init()过程中的连接是通过

文档评论(0)

mx597651661 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档